Shreyas Iyer's team is playing the same brand of cricket that helped them reach the final last year. The batting has plenty of firepower and depth, while the bowling looks organised. Out of the three matches, they have won two, while one was lost due to rain.
Meanwhile, Sunrisers Hyderabad, led by stand-in captain Ishan Kishan, started their campaign with a six-wicket defeat to defending champions – Royal Challengers Bangalore. However, they made a commendable comeback against Kolkata Knight Riders to win by 65 runs. In their most recent encounter, they were defeated by Lucknow Super Giants. The Orange Army will look to return to winning ways on Saturday.

Maharaja Yadvendra Singh International Cricket Stadium Pitch Report
It will not be easy to pull off extraordinary shots right from the start at the Maharaja Yadvendra Singh International Cricket Stadium. Batsmen should spend some time at the crease to understand the conditions. It is expected that the spinners will play an important role, especially in the last part of the match. The venue hosted Punjab's clash against Gujarat Titans, where the home team chased down the target of 163 runs in 19.1 overs with three wickets remaining.

Probable best performers of PBKS vs SRH match
Probable best batsman: Heinrich Klaasen

Heinrich Klaasen has been in great form, scoring 145 runs in three innings at an average of 48.33 and a strike rate of 47.96 in IPL 2026. He has already scored two fifties this season. His battle with Yuzvendra Chahal in the middle overs could be interesting to watch.
